AK18 LFS is a 2018 MG ZS in Red with a 1,498c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 8 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.
Across all 2018 MG ZS models, the average MOT pass rate is 82.9% with a typical mileage of 33,011 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a MG ZS f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 14,838 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AK18 LFS,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The MG ZS typically stays on UK roads for around 25 years. At 8 years old, this MG ZS is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
